From our Sound Design GuideLines document: https://docs.google.com/document/d/1XX0 ... sp=sharingfretflyer wrote: Fri May 03, 2024 1:25 pm
More important, as a starting point, can your patch authors normalize the loudness of all your patches so they don't come blasting through the speakers when previewing some of them? I have to remember to turn down my audio interfaces before trying new patches.
The potential for Synthmaster 3 is utterly fantastic and I hope the authors put more velocity dynamics into the presets their construct.
Performance Controls: Make sure you use at least the 2 of the following performance modulation sources in your patches:
MIDI Velocity
Channel Aftertouch
Modulation Wheel
Pitch Wheel
So yes we expect our sound designers to use velocity / aftertouch / mod wheel.
About normalization: I am the one who does the final normalization. Normalization is tricky though, when there is velocity / aftertouch / modwheel modulation. At which velocity / aftertouch / modwheel are you going to normalize? That's the real question
